Effortless November Meal Planning for Busy Parents: Create Healthy Family Meals

Healthy family meals: white chicken chili with toppings.

Streamline Your Family Meals This Holiday Season

The holiday season brings joy and excitement, but it can also introduce a level of chaos, especially when it comes to meal planning. For busy parents and grandparents looking to nourish their families without the stress, a well-structured meal plan can be a lifesaver. This week’s meal plan focuses on simplicity and efficiency, featuring easy recipes like skillet meals and quesadillas that are nutritious and appealing—even to picky eaters.

Healthy Family Meals: A Foundation for Festivity

Feeding children can be a daunting task, particularly when introducing new flavors or maintaining healthy options during holiday feasts. By prioritizing balanced meals, parents can instill lifelong healthy eating habits in their kids. This week’s meal plan offers solutions that cater to those needs while still allowing room for festive treats. Incorporating a mix of protein, whole grains, and colorful vegetables ensures that meals are not only satisfying but also nutritionally rich.

Creating Enthusiasm with Cultural Recipes

Exploring global cuisine can be an engaging way to introduce children to diverse flavors. The meal plan encourages families to adapt their favorite cultural dishes—adding a fun twist to weeknight meals. For instance, making a taco night with traditional fillings from various cultures can spark curiosity and conversation at the dinner table, allowing children to connect with their culinary heritage while enjoying a fun, interactive experience.

Practical Lunchbox Ideas for School Days

As you prepare meals for the family, don’t forget about school lunches. These meals should be portable, healthy, and appealing for kids. Utilize leftovers—such as chicken from quesadillas or veggies from stir-fries—when packing lunches to minimize waste while maximizing nutrition. The key is to blend ease of preparation with creativity, ensuring that your kids have meals that they look forward to eating at school.

Addressing Common Myths About Kids' Food Preferences

A common misconception among parents is that toddlers and young children are inherently picky eaters. However, it’s often a result of exposure. Repeatedly offering various foods without pressure can help children develop their tastes. Incorporating new healthy family meals and cultural recipes can expand their palate and encourage willingness to try more diverse foods. This meal plan introduces recipes that are not only kid-friendly but also flexible—encouraging culinary experimentation.
